The Political Economy of War and
Peace in Afghanistan
By Barnett Rubin, 1999
The 20-year old Afghan conflict has created an open war economy,
affecting Afghanistan and surrounding areas. Not only has
Afghanistan become the worldÕs largest opium producer and
a center for arms dealing, but it supports a multi-billion
dollar trade in goods smuggled from Dubai to Pakistan.
